繁体   English   中英

IE或Firefox根本不执行Java脚本,但Chrome没有问题

[英]Java script not being executed (at all) by I.E. or Firefox but Chrome has no issue

因此,我刚写了很多JavaScript脚本,只是发现Firefox和8都忽略了我在Chrome中看到的内容(根据我们的统计,这是目标浏览器)。 代码如下:

   <script src="http://ajax.aspnetcdn.com/ajax/jQuery/jquery-1.7.2.min.js" type="text/javascript"></script>
   <script type="text/jscript" language="javascript" >

   alert("here");
    $(window).load(function () {

        $('div#pop-up').hide();
        $('div#pop-up-side').hide();
   ....

我把

   alert("here");

并很快意识到,即使GETS也要提醒的唯一浏览器是“ Chrome”。 关于什么可以解决此问题的任何想法? 我不确定还能为您提供什么。

type属性是可选的,如果不存在,则默认为text/javascript language属性被浏览器忽略。 您可以忽略两者。

另外,最好使用.ready()

$(document).ready(function () {
    alert("here");
    $('div#pop-up').hide();
    $('div#pop-up-side').hide();
    ...

并检查控制台中的错误。

使用正确的类型(不是text/jscript而是text/javascript )在Firefox中会有所帮助。 不知道您在IE中看到了什么...

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M